Recorded constituents

What analytical work has found in this species, at which plant part and preparation. A measured constituent is a fact about material, not about effect.

SubstancePlant partPreparationConcentrationAnalytical methodSource
Aporphine alkaloidsAerial part of plantsSolvent extractionNuclear Magnetic Resonance (NMR)Resolve DOI
Furan derivativesWoodSolvent extractionStandard Chromatographic tests (paper- thin layer- and column chromatography)Resolve DOI
MethyleugenolLeavesEssential oil1.2 PercentGC-FIDResolve DOI
MyrceneLeavesEssential oil1 PercentGC-FIDResolve DOI
AlkaloidsLeavesSolvent extractionPhytochemical screeningNo resolvable identifier
AlkaloidsBarkSolvent extraction0.32 PercentStandard Chromatographic tests (paper- thin layer- and column chromatography)No resolvable identifier
AlkaloidsLeavesSolvent extraction0.24 PercentStandard Chromatographic tests (paper- thin layer- and column chromatography)No resolvable identifier
EpoxidesLeavesEssential oil2.79 PercentGC-MSNo resolvable identifier
LignansStem / stalkSolvent extractionNuclear Magnetic Resonance (NMR)No resolvable identifier
MyrceneLeavesEssential oil5 PercentGC-MSNo resolvable identifier
TanninsLeavesSolvent extractionPhytochemical screeningNo resolvable identifier

Cited sources

The literature the compendium cites for this species. Metatron Health has no relationship with these authors or journals and earns nothing from citing them.

  1. Khatun Amina., Haque Tania., Akter Mahfuja., Akter Subarna., Jhumur Afrin., Rahman Mahmudur., Rahman Md Mahfizur. Cytotoxicity potentials of eleven Bangladeshi medicinal plants. Thescientificworldjournal, 2014.
  2. Yang, JH., Li, L., Wang, YS., Zhao, JF., Zhang, HB., Luo, SD. Two new aporphine alkaloids from Litsea glutinosa. Helvetica chimica acta, 2005, vol. 88, no. 9, p. 2523-2526. DOI
  3. Chowdhury, Jasim Uddin., Bhuiyan, Md. Nazrul Islam., Nandi, Nemai Chandra. Aromatic plants of Bangladesh: Essential oils of leaves and fruits of Litsea glutinosa (Lour.) C.B. Robinson . Bangladesh journal of botany, 2008, vol. 37, no. 1, p. 81-83.
  4. Son, Le C., Dai, Do N., Thang, Tran D., Huyen, Duong D., Ogunwande, Isiaka A. Analysis of the Essential Oils from Five Vietnamese Litsea Species (Lauraceae) . Journal of essential oil bearing plants, 2014, vol. 17, no. 5, p. 960-971. DOI
  5. Pan, Jian-Yu., Zhang, Si., Wu, Jun., Li, Qing-Xin., Xiao, Zhi-Hui. Litseaglutinan A and Lignans from Litsea glutinosa. Helvetica chimica acta, 2010, vol. 93, no. 5, p. 951-957.
  6. Agrawal, Nisha., Pareek, Deepika., Dobhal, Sonal., Sharma, Mahesh C., Joshi, Yogesh C., Dobhal, Mahabeer P. Butanolides from Methanolic Extract of Litsea glutinosa. Chemistry & biodiversity, 2013, vol. 10, no. 3, p. 394-400. DOI
  7. Hart, N. K., Johns, S. R., Lamberton, John A., Loder, John W., Moorhouse, Anne., Sioumis, A. A., Smith, T. K. Alkaloids of several Litsea species from New Guinea. Australian journal of chemistry, 1969, p. 2259-2262.
